Simmons Bank is a regional financial institution headquartered in Pine Bluff, Arkansas, that has been serving customers since its founding in 1903. The bank is a wholly owned subsidiary of Simmons First National Corporation, a Mid-South based financial holding company traded on NASDAQ. Simmons Bank operates branches across six states including Arkansas, Kansas, Missouri, Oklahoma, Tennessee, and Texas, offering comprehensive financial solutions delivered with a client-centric approach. The bank provides a full range of personal and business banking services including checking and savings accounts, credit cards, home loans, home equity lines of credit, wealth management, and trust services. For business customers, Simmons Bank offers business checking and savings accounts, business credit cards, commercial loans, treasury management services, and payment management solutions tailored to small businesses, growing companies, large corporations, and non-profit organizations. The bank delivers digital banking capabilities through online and mobile platforms that enable customers to view account balances, send bill payments, transfer funds, make mobile deposits, and manage finances securely from anywhere. Simmons Bank emphasizes community involvement and maintains a strong commitment to customer satisfaction, actively supporting local initiatives and charitable organizations throughout its footprint. The bank has grown through strategic acquisitions of community banks and financial institutions that share its values of outstanding customer service and community commitment.
